How they compare

Tunisia currently reports 450.64 against 399.57 in Viet Nam, a difference of 51.07.

That makes Tunisia's figure about 1.1 times Viet Nam's.

The two have swapped places 5 times across 24 shared years of data; in 1995 it was Viet Nam ahead.

Tunisia ranks 5th and Viet Nam ranks 8th of 66 countries.

Across the 3 decades both report, Tunisia averaged higher in 1 and Viet Nam in 2.

Head to head by decade

Decade Tunisia Viet Nam Difference Ahead
1990s 457.45 576.88 119.43 Viet Nam
2000s 441.29 473.15 31.86 Viet Nam
2010s 376.95 325.05 51.9 Tunisia

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

This dataset provides annual estimates of carbon dioxide (CO2) emissions for 66 countries across 45 industries from 1995 to 2018. It details both aggregate emissions and emissions intensity, specifically direct and indirect CO2 emissions per unit of output. The data is structured to allow for analysis of emission trends by country, industry, and a combination of both. CO2 emissions from fuel consumption are in millions of metric tons of CO2. CO2 emissions intensities are in metric tons of CO2 emissions per $1 million USD of output. CO2 emissions multipliers are in metric tons of CO2 emissions per $1 million USD of output.
